A flowing handwritten script with a consistent rightward slant and smooth, pen-like curves. Strokes are generally fine and clean, with moderate thick–thin modulation that reads like quick calligraphy rather than a brush. Uppercase forms are large and expressive with generous loops and long entry/exit strokes, while the lowercase is compact and delicate, giving the design a noticeable scale contrast between cases. Spacing and widths vary naturally from letter to letter, creating an organic rhythm; many joins and terminals taper to sharp points, and several letters feature extended ascenders/descenders that add movement across a line.

Well-suited for wedding and event materials, greeting cards, and upscale personal stationery where a handwritten flourish is desired. It can work effectively for logos, boutique branding, and packaging accents, and for short display copy such as pull quotes or headings when set with ample size and spacing.

The overall tone is graceful and intimate, evoking handwritten notes, signatures, and classic stationery. Its looping capitals and light touch feel refined and a bit formal, while the lively slant keeps it friendly and personal rather than rigid.

Designed to capture the look of quick, confident penmanship with calligraphic polish: expressive capitals for emphasis, a restrained lowercase for continuity, and a light, slanted rhythm that reads as personal and elegant in display settings.

The sample text shows strong word-shape continuity and a distinctly decorative presence in capitals, which can dominate at larger sizes. Because the lowercase is comparatively small and light, the font’s character comes through most clearly when given room to breathe and used where elegance is prioritized over dense readability.
